Nimrod Kozlovski is the CEO and Co-Founder of Cytactic, a crisis readiness and management platform that enhances cyber crisis management through data-driven insights. As a Senior Lecturer and Adjunct Professor at Tel Aviv University, Kozlovski co-initiated the cybersecurity studies program and teaches various courses on information security and internet law. With extensive experience in the tech industry, Kozlovski co-founded PLYmedia, an award-winning interactive video and online advertisement company, and served as a General Partner at Herzog Strategic, providing consulting on cybersecurity and digital transformation. Additional roles include Partner and Head of Tech Regulation at Herzog, Fox & Neeman, and director at JVP Labs, focusing on investments in cybersecurity and big data. Education includes a post-doctorate in Computer Science from Yale University, advanced law degrees from Yale Law School and Tel Aviv University, and a summer program at the University of Oxford.
